DC Motor Speed Controller Max PWM 3500W, DC 10V-50V Rated 60A/ Max 100A Brush Motor Stepless Speed Controller With Forward-Brake-Reverse Switch Ajustable Potentiometer
DC Motor Speed Controller Max PWM 3500W, DC 10V-50V Rated 60A/ Max 100A Brush Motor Stepless Speed Controller With Forward-Brake-Reverse Switch Ajustable Potentiometer